Exhibition in honor of maestro S. Povilaitis

A permanent exhibition in honor of maestro S. Povilaitis is exhibited in the Palanga concert hall. The exhibition is permanently open to participants of Palanga concert hall events.

The maestro's family, friends and fans donated a number of valuable exhibits to the exhibition organized on the initiative of the Palanga Concert Hall. Among more than 100 exhibits, you can see not only S. Povilaitis' favorite microphone, the travel bag with which the maestro went to his performances, details of his stage appearance, but also various awards and personal items.
